More about the book

John Hedgecoe, the world's best-selling author of practical photography books, presents the guide vacationers have been dreaming of: a comprehensive, easy-to-follow, abundantly illustrated and practical handbook on taking keepsake holiday pictures. Nothing challenges amateurs more than vacation photography. Faced with diverse subject matter-from portraits to landscapes--they've got one chance to get the picture right and preserve precious memories. With Hedgecoe's expert advice and novel techniques, vividly illustrated with 250 photos of popular vacation locales from mountaintop to seashore, they'll succeed. Drawing on an immense wealth of knowledge, Hedgecoe gives professional guidance on the minimum amount of equipment needed, how to deal with intense heat and cold, and how lighting conditions (including reflective, shimmering snowscapes) affect the image. There's information on camera care, creating a successful composition, getting all the angles on a site, and using snapshots to tell a story. With this innovative approach, anyone can create memorable images.
